Meanings and Origins of the name Eboni

Eboni is a variant of the name Ebony, derived from the Greek word "ebenos," meaning black. The original reference was to the dense, dark wood highly prized for its beauty and durability. Traditionally, the name conjures images of its striking color, often symbolizing depth and mystery.

The name has cultural significance as well, being used to signify richness and class in many communities. In some African traditions, ebony wood is a symbol of power and protection, providing a pet named Eboni with an association of strength and guardian-like qualities.
